PLUS distribution center completed

HVBM Vastgoed and Bruil deliver DC Deventer to PLUS The new distribution center in Deventer is delivered by HBC to PLUS. The distribution center is coming further furnished and filled with thousands of fresh products. At the end of May, the first deliveries will go to the supermarkets.

High sustainability requirements Sustainability requirements played an important role in the development of the new distribution center. The building and the surrounding grounds have been designed to be circular and nature-inclusive. Energy is generated with an own solar power installation of over 14,000 solar panels with an installed capacity of 8 MWp, generating over 7 million kWh of solar power annually. For employees, PLUS creates a pleasant and attractive working environment, with plenty of daylight and a nice climate. Thanks to all these efforts, the BREEAM Excellent design certificate was achieved.

Space for subletting Upon completion, not all of the distribution center will be used by PLUS. Therefore, a portion of approximately 15,000 m² of office and logistics warehouse space is offered for subletting.

About DC Deventer The new distribution center will replace the existing distribution center in Deventer. The building is 77,000 m² in size and stands on a plot of over 13 hectares, making it three times the size of the current distribution center. The building will soon house 3,500 unique fresh products, which will be loaded onto trucks through the 142 dock doors and sent to the 280 PLUS and Coop stores that the distribution center supplies.

PLUS’s new fresh distribution center at A1 business park in Deventer is a development by HBC, a collaboration between HVBM Vastgoed and Bruil Bouw Groep.
